Increased Privacy

Another advantage of online counseling is the increased privacy it offers. Some students may feel uncomfortable seeking support in person, especially if they are worried about being seen by their peers or faculty members. Online counseling allows students to maintain their anonymity and seek help without fear of judgment or stigma.

Furthermore, online counseling platforms often have strict privacy and confidentiality policies in place to protect their clients' personal information. This can help students feel more at ease when discussing sensitive topics with their counselors, knowing that their privacy is being respected.

Expanded Reach

Online counseling also expands the reach of mental health services to students who may not have access to in-person counseling. This can be particularly beneficial for students who attend colleges in rural areas or have limited transportation options.

Through online platforms, students can connect with counselors from various locations, allowing them to access support no matter where they are geographically. This expanded reach ensures that all students, regardless of their location, have the opportunity to receive the counseling they need.

Enhanced Support Networks

Online counseling can also help students expand their support networks. In addition to one-on-one counseling sessions, many online platforms offer group counseling sessions, support groups, and discussion forums.

These additional resources can help students connect with peers who may be going through similar challenges. Sharing experiences and receiving support from others can be incredibly empowering and validating, and can help students feel less alone in their struggles.
